  • Hydrocarbon CVD synthesis of carbon nanotubes (CNTs) is not well understood because it does not follow intuitive gas phase kinetics. Consequently, progress towards industrialization of CNT synthesis has been arduously slow. However, an intuitive understanding of the CNT CVD process can be gained through understanding of the chemistry of free radical condensates that are produced during the pyrolysis of any hydrocarbon. It is our contention that free radical condensates act as an intermediate and reaction medium for hydrocarbon-based CVD production of nanotubes. The insight gained from this understanding can be used to explain much of the literature and to coherently direct the efforts to industrialize the CVD process and produce higher quality nanotubes for materials research and commercial exploitation.
